Ashley played for the University of Texas her first two years as a professional. After completing her studies at the University of Southern California, Ashley was able to graduate in the year 2014. Her time in Texas included participation at the 2012 US Olympic Trials, 100m backstrokes. Brewer is an USC graduated, was employed by Cox 7 Arizona as a reporter on the sidelines of football matches in college. She then became a weekend sports anchor at Tucson Arizona's KGUN TV.
